Output 04588fe3dc04c4af9db392a9df2035e2015f49b720f4765a3dfee4b6880b559c:4

value
43530574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f657fd6ebf3650cf06dcc48ca6853bc5f30e6a9 OP_EQUAL
address
MGba1xJ4DxQDrnRiSCUviSGRHLCGFyvdRi
transaction
04588fe3dc04c4af9db392a9df2035e2015f49b720f4765a3dfee4b6880b559c
spent
true